The Last Nights of Summer

The whirling neon-pink disc
flits in and out of the shadows
of another suburbian twilight
while far below
the rows of fickle streetlamps
illuminate our return to childhood.
With a sweeping insanity,
the game is played under
care-free skies filled with
the infinite possibilities of more
until we become lost within
the waves of a two-gallon jug of life.
And there we remain afloat,
dancing away our nights
beneath summer's full moons
and tempting the fates of tomorrow
from the sugary straits of tonight
until the nearing dawn arrives
and sends us scurrying
down our separate trails.
